Success StoryLaura Cleary



Laura Cleary

Author: Jeffrey Wheeler

Planning Unit: Horticulture

Major Program: Local Food Systems

Outcome: Long-Term Outcome

Laura Cleary began her journey into the field of wine as an undergraduate student studying Food Science at UK.  She began taking classes in Enology and Viticulture starting in 2014 and received a Certificate in Distillation, Wine and Brewing from UK in 2016.   Laura served as a Viticulture and Enology Research Technician at the UKHRF from 2016-2017, where she learned to both work in the vineyard as well as performing laborotory analysis on both juice and wine.  Laura moved on from this position at UK to take a job as Vineyard Manager for Hempridge Vineyard in Waddy, KY from 2017-2018.  Laura was then recruited by Tim Wright at Wise Bird Cider Co. in Lexington to become his assistant Cidermaker starting in 2018.  The quality of cider now being poured at Wise Bird can be highly attributed to Laura's natural talent, her hard work, and from her experiences working with the UK Viticulture and Enology Team.
